クラスター ID を使用してクラスターの詳細を取得するには、DescribeClusterDetail オペレーションを呼び出します。
今すぐお試しください
テスト
RAM 認証
|
アクション |
アクセスレベル |
リソースタイプ |
条件キー |
依存アクション |
|
cs:DescribeClusterDetail |
get |
*Cluster
|
なし | なし |
リクエスト構文
GET /clusters/{ClusterId} HTTP/1.1
パスパラメーター
|
パラメーター |
型 |
必須 / 任意 |
説明 |
例 |
| ClusterId |
string |
必須 |
クラスター ID。 |
cdde1f21ae22e483ebcb068a6eb7f**** |
リクエストパラメーター
|
パラメーター |
型 |
必須 / 任意 |
説明 |
例 |
リクエストパラメーターは必要ありません。
レスポンスフィールド
|
フィールド |
型 |
説明 |
例 |
|
object |
レスポンスボディのパラメーター。 |
||
| cluster_id |
string |
クラスター ID。 |
c82e6987e2961451182edacd74faf**** |
| cluster_type |
string |
クラスターのタイプ。
|
Kubernetes |
| created |
string |
クラスターが作成された時刻。 |
2025-04-07T09:57:26+08:00 |
| init_version |
string |
クラスターの初期バージョン。 |
1.32.1-aliyun.1 |
| current_version |
string |
クラスターの現在の Kubernetes バージョン。ACK でサポートされている Kubernetes バージョンの詳細については、「Kubernetesバージョンリリースの概要」をご参照ください。 |
1.32.1-aliyun.1 |
| next_version |
string |
クラスターをアップグレードできる Kubernetes バージョン。 |
1.xx.x-aliyun.1 |
| deletion_protection |
boolean |
クラスターの削除保護が有効になっているかどうかを示します。削除保護が有効になっている場合、コンソールまたは API 呼び出しによってクラスターが誤って削除されることはありません。有効な値:
|
true |
docker_version
deprecated
|
string |
クラスターの Docker バージョン。 |
19.03.5 |
external_loadbalancer_id
deprecated
|
string |
Ingress LoadBalancer インスタンスの ID。 |
lb-2zehc05z3b8dwiifh**** |
| meta_data |
string |
クラスターのメタデータ。 |
\"Addons\":*** |
| name |
string |
クラスター名。 |
cluster-demo |
network_mode
deprecated
|
string |
クラスターで使用されるネットワークタイプ (Virtual Private Cloud (VPC) など)。 |
vpc |
| region_id |
string |
クラスターがデプロイされているリージョン ID。 |
cn-beijing |
| resource_group_id |
string |
クラスターが属するリソースグループの ID。 |
rg-acfmyvw3wjm**** |
| security_group_id |
string |
クラスターが属するセキュリティグループの ID。 |
sg-25yq**** |
| size |
integer |
クラスター内のノード (マスターノードとワーカーノード) の総数。 |
5 |
| state |
string |
クラスターの状態。有効な値:
|
running |
| tags |
array |
クラスターのタグ。 |
|
| tag |
クラスターにアタッチされているタグ。 |
||
| updated |
string |
クラスターが最後に更新された時刻。 |
2025-04-10T13:28:09+08:00 |
| vpc_id |
string |
クラスターが属する Virtual Private Cloud (VPC) の ID。 |
vpc-2zecuu62b9zw7a7qn**** |
vswitch_id
deprecated
|
string |
vSwitch の ID。このパラメーターは非推奨です。コントロールプレーンの vSwitch をクエリするには、このレスポンスの |
vsw-2zete8s4qocqg0mf6****,vsw-2zete8s4qocqg0mf6**** |
subnet_cidr
deprecated
|
string |
Pod の CIDR ブロック。 |
172.20.xx.xx/16 |
zone_id
deprecated
|
string |
クラスターがデプロイされているアベイラビリティゾーンの ID。 |
cn-beijing-a |
| master_url |
string |
クラスターの内部およびパブリック API サーバーエンドポイント。 |
{\"intranet_api_server_endpoint\":\"https://192.168.xx.xx:6443\"***} |
private_zone
deprecated
|
boolean |
クラスターで PrivateZone が有効になっているかどうかを示します。
デフォルト値:false。 |
false |
| profile |
string |
クラスターのサブタイプ。
|
Default |
| cluster_spec |
string |
Pro XL、Pro 2XL、および Pro 4XL は、プロビジョニングされたコントロールプレーンを持つ ACK Pro が提供する 3 つのティアです。この機能は、コントロールプレーンリソースを事前に割り当てて専用化することで、高い API 同時実行性と Pod スケジューリングを保証し、AI トレーニングと推論、超大規模クラスター、およびミッションクリティカルなワークロードに最適です。 Pro 版クラスターおよびプロビジョニングされたコントロールプレーンを持つクラスターの管理料金の詳細については、「クラスター管理料金」をご参照ください。 |
ack.pro.small |
| worker_ram_role_name |
string |
ECS インスタンスにクラスターのワーカーノードとして機能する権限を付与する、ワーカー RAM ロールの名前。 |
KubernetesWorkerRole-ec87d15b-edca-4302-933f-c8a16bf0**** |
| maintenance_window | maintenance_window |
クラスターのメンテナンスウィンドウの設定。この機能は ACK Pro クラスターでのみ利用可能です。 |
|
parameters
deprecated
|
object |
クラスターの Resource Orchestration Service (ROS) のパラメーター。 |
|
|
string |
ROS パラメーター。 |
"ALIYUN::Region": "cn-qingdao" |
|
| container_cidr |
string |
Flannel ネットワークの Pod CIDR ブロック。 |
172.20.xx.xx/16 |
| service_cidr |
string |
Service の CIDR ブロック。 |
172.21.xx.xx/20 |
| proxy_mode |
string |
kube-proxy のプロキシモード。
|
ipvs |
| timezone |
string |
クラスターのタイムゾーン。 |
Asia/Shanghai |
| node_cidr_mask |
string |
各ノードのサブネットマスクの長さ。ノードごとに割り当て可能な IP アドレス数を決定します。このパラメーターは、Flannel ネットワークプラグインを使用するクラスターにのみ適用されます。 ノード割り当てのサブネットマスクサイズは、ノードが割り当てることができる IP アドレス数を決定します。 |
26 |
| ip_stack |
string |
クラスターの IP スタック。有効な値:
|
ipv4 |
| cluster_domain |
string |
クラスター内部のドメイン名。 |
cluster.local |
| extra_sans |
array |
API サーバー証明書のカスタムサブジェクト代替名 (SAN)。 |
|
|
string |
証明書の SAN。 |
192.168.xx.xx |
|
| rrsa_config |
object |
RAM Roles for Service Accounts (RRSA) の設定。 |
|
| enabled |
boolean |
RRSA 機能が有効になっているかどうかを示します。 |
true |
| oidc_name |
string |
OIDC ID プロバイダーの名前。 |
ack-rrsa-*** |
| oidc_arn |
string |
OIDC ID プロバイダーの ARN。 |
acs:ram::1138***:oidc-provider/ack-rrsa-*** |
| max_oidc_token_expiration |
string |
OIDC トークンの最大有効期間。 |
12h |
| audience |
string |
OIDC トークンのデフォルトのオーディエンス。複数の値を指定する場合、値はカンマ (,) で区切ります。この値は、OIDC トークンのオーディエンス ( |
https://kubernetes.default.svc,https://example.***.com |
| issuer |
string |
OIDC トークンの発行者。複数の値を指定する場合、値はカンマ (,) で区切ります。最初の値は、発行者 ( |
https://oidc-ack-***,https://kubernetes.default.svc |
| open_api_configuration_url |
string |
OIDC ディスカバリー文書の URL。 |
https://oidc-ack-***/c12b990***/.well-known/openid-configuration |
| jwks_url |
string |
OIDC 公開キーを含む JSON Web Key Set (JWKS) の URL。 |
https://oidc-ack-***/c12b990***/keys |
| vswitch_ids |
array |
コントロールプレーンの vSwitch。 |
|
|
string |
コントロールプレーンの vSwitch。 |
vsw-2zete8s4qocqg0mf6**** |
|
| operation_policy |
object |
クラスターの自動運用ポリシー。 |
|
| cluster_auto_upgrade |
object |
クラスターの自動アップグレード設定。 |
|
| enabled |
boolean |
クラスターの自動アップグレードが有効になっているかどうかを示します。 |
true |
| channel |
string |
自動アップグレードチャネル。詳細については、「アップグレードチャネル」をご参照ください。 有効な値:
|
patch |
| control_plane_config |
object |
ACK 専用クラスターのコントロールプレーンの設定。 |
|
| charge_type |
string |
コントロールプレーンノードの課金方法。 |
PrePaid |
| period |
integer |
コントロールプレーンノードのサブスクリプション期間。 |
1 |
| period_unit |
string |
サブスクリプション期間の単位。 |
Month |
| auto_renew |
boolean |
ノードの自動更新が有効になっているかどうかを示します。 |
true |
| auto_renew_period |
integer |
ノードの自動更新期間。 |
1 |
| instance_types |
array |
ノードのインスタンスタイプ。 |
|
|
string |
インスタンスタイプ。 |
ecs.g6.large |
|
| image_type |
string |
OS イメージタイプ。 |
AliyunLinux3 |
| image_id |
string |
イメージ ID。 |
aliyun_3_x64_20G_alibase_20240819 |
| key_pair |
string |
キーペアの名前。 |
ack |
| system_disk_category |
string |
ノードのシステムディスクのタイプ。 |
cloud_essd |
| system_disk_size |
integer |
コントロールプレーンノードのシステムディスクのサイズ (GiB)。値は 40 以上である必要があります。 |
120 |
| system_disk_snapshot_policy_id |
string |
コントロールプレーンノードのシステムディスクの自動スナップショットポリシーの ID。 |
sp-2zej1nogjvovnz4z**** |
| system_disk_performance_level |
string |
ノードのシステムディスクのパフォーマンスレベル。このパラメーターは ESSD に対してのみ有効です。 |
PL1 |
| system_disk_provisioned_iops |
integer |
ノードのシステムディスクにプロビジョニングされた読み取り/書き込み IOPS。 |
1000 |
| system_disk_bursting_enabled |
boolean |
ノードのシステムディスクでバーストが有効になっているかどうかを示します。 |
true |
| deploymentset_id |
string |
配置セットの ID。 |
ds-bp10b35imuam5amw**** |
| cloud_monitor_flags |
boolean |
CloudMonitor エージェントがノードにインストールされているかどうかを示します。 |
true |
| soc_enabled |
boolean |
MLPS セキュリティ強化が有効になっているかどうかを示します。 |
false |
| security_hardening_os |
boolean |
Alibaba Cloud OS セキュリティ強化が有効になっているかどうかを示します。 |
true |
| cpu_policy |
string |
ノードの CPU 管理ポリシー。 |
none |
| runtime |
string |
コンテナランタイムの名前。 |
containerd |
| node_port_range |
string |
Service の NodePort 範囲。 |
30000-32767 |
| size |
integer |
コントロールプレーンノードの数。 |
3 |
| instance_metadata_options | InstanceMetadataOptions |
ECS インスタンスのメタデータアクセス設定。 |
|
| auto_mode |
object |
インテリジェントなホスティングモードの設定。 |
|
| enable |
boolean |
インテリジェントなホスティングモードが有効になっているかどうかを示します。 |
false |
| control_plane_endpoints_config |
object |
クラスターの接続設定。 |
|
| internal_dns_config |
object |
クラスターの内部 DNS 設定。このパラメーターは、ACK マネージドクラスターにのみ適用されます。kubelet や kube-proxy などのノードコンポーネントは、内部ドメイン名を使用して API サーバーにアクセスします。この機能が無効な場合、これらのコンポーネントは、その Classic Load Balancer (CLB) インスタンスの IP アドレスを使用して API サーバーにアクセスします。 |
|
| bind_vpcs |
array |
内部ドメイン名が有効になる VPC。デフォルトでは、これにはクラスターがデプロイされている VPC が含まれます。 |
|
|
string |
内部ドメイン名が有効になる VPC。 |
vpc-xxxxxx |
|
| enabled |
boolean |
内部 DNS ベースのアクセスが有効になっているかどうかを示します。
|
true |
例
成功レスポンス
JSONJSON
{
"cluster_id": "c82e6987e2961451182edacd74faf****",
"cluster_type": "Kubernetes",
"created": "2025-04-07T09:57:26+08:00",
"init_version": "1.32.1-aliyun.1",
"current_version": "1.32.1-aliyun.1",
"next_version": "1.xx.x-aliyun.1",
"deletion_protection": true,
"docker_version": "19.03.5",
"external_loadbalancer_id": "lb-2zehc05z3b8dwiifh****",
"meta_data": "\\\"Addons\\\":***",
"name": "cluster-demo",
"network_mode": "vpc",
"region_id": "cn-beijing",
"resource_group_id": "rg-acfmyvw3wjm****",
"security_group_id": "sg-25yq****",
"size": 5,
"state": "running",
"tags": [
{
"key": "env",
"value": "prod"
}
],
"updated": "2025-04-10T13:28:09+08:00",
"vpc_id": "vpc-2zecuu62b9zw7a7qn****",
"vswitch_id": "vsw-2zete8s4qocqg0mf6****,vsw-2zete8s4qocqg0mf6****",
"subnet_cidr": "172.20.xx.xx/16",
"zone_id": "cn-beijing-a",
"master_url": "{\\\"intranet_api_server_endpoint\\\":\\\"https://192.168.xx.xx:6443\\\"***}",
"private_zone": false,
"profile": "Default",
"cluster_spec": "ack.pro.small",
"worker_ram_role_name": "KubernetesWorkerRole-ec87d15b-edca-4302-933f-c8a16bf0****",
"maintenance_window": {
"enable": false,
"maintenance_time": "2020-10-15T12:31:00.000+08:00",
"duration": "3h",
"weekly_period": "Monday,Thursday",
"recurrence": "FREQ=WEEKLY;INTERVAL=4;BYDAY=MO,TU"
},
"parameters": {
"key": "\"ALIYUN::Region\": \"cn-qingdao\""
},
"container_cidr": "172.20.xx.xx/16",
"service_cidr": "172.21.xx.xx/20",
"proxy_mode": "ipvs",
"timezone": "Asia/Shanghai",
"node_cidr_mask": "26",
"ip_stack": "ipv4",
"cluster_domain": "cluster.local",
"extra_sans": [
"192.168.xx.xx"
],
"rrsa_config": {
"enabled": true,
"oidc_name": "ack-rrsa-***",
"oidc_arn": "acs:ram::1138***:oidc-provider/ack-rrsa-***",
"max_oidc_token_expiration": "12h",
"audience": "https://kubernetes.default.svc,https://example.***.com",
"issuer": "https://oidc-ack-***,https://kubernetes.default.svc",
"open_api_configuration_url": "https://oidc-ack-***/c12b990***/.well-known/openid-configuration",
"jwks_url": "https://oidc-ack-***/c12b990***/keys"
},
"vswitch_ids": [
"vsw-2zete8s4qocqg0mf6****"
],
"operation_policy": {
"cluster_auto_upgrade": {
"enabled": true,
"channel": "patch"
}
},
"control_plane_config": {
"charge_type": "PrePaid",
"period": 1,
"period_unit": "Month",
"auto_renew": true,
"auto_renew_period": 1,
"instance_types": [
"ecs.g6.large"
],
"image_type": "AliyunLinux3",
"image_id": "aliyun_3_x64_20G_alibase_20240819",
"key_pair": "ack",
"system_disk_category": "cloud_essd",
"system_disk_size": 120,
"system_disk_snapshot_policy_id": "sp-2zej1nogjvovnz4z****",
"system_disk_performance_level": "PL1",
"system_disk_provisioned_iops": 1000,
"system_disk_bursting_enabled": true,
"deploymentset_id": "ds-bp10b35imuam5amw****",
"cloud_monitor_flags": true,
"soc_enabled": false,
"security_hardening_os": true,
"cpu_policy": "none",
"runtime": "containerd",
"node_port_range": "30000-32767",
"size": 3,
"instance_metadata_options": {
"http_tokens": "optional"
}
},
"auto_mode": {
"enable": false
},
"control_plane_endpoints_config": {
"internal_dns_config": {
"bind_vpcs": [
"vpc-xxxxxx"
],
"enabled": true
}
}
}
エラーコード
完全なリストについては、「エラーコード」をご参照ください。
変更履歴
完全なリストについては、「変更履歴」をご参照ください。